Yokohama said its Avid W4s’s “ride comfort and noise was rated best on the road and the tire delivered competitive performance on the track.”
All the tires were tested on 2008 BMW E90 328i Coupes on a 6.6-mile loop of expressway, state highway and county roads, as well as on Tire Rack’s closed-course test track.
“It means a lot to have an independent organization such as Tire Rack do the testing and compare our tires against our competitors,” said Shawn Denlein, Yokohama director of consumer tire sales. “Being named the best by Tire Rack two years in a row (2007 and 2008) validates Yokohama’s commitment to produce the best tires on the road.” (Tire Review/Akron)
